Output 2eb58b1285901bdb25732d36251a273cb63e90bc2e7dcc1a3430f8a0d26d4676:1

value
43283143
script pubkey
OP_0 OP_PUSHBYTES_20 a1e8f6643bf0c2dbf17d0770341381154ef8c83f
address
bc1q5850vepm7rpdhutaqacrgyupz4803jplj5udls
transaction
2eb58b1285901bdb25732d36251a273cb63e90bc2e7dcc1a3430f8a0d26d4676
confirmations
27994
spent
true